Job Description:
As part of our healthcare platform, MCR owns and operates outpatient medical facilities, including a pain management clinic and ambulatory surgery center. The Accounting and Financial Operations role will support the day-to-day financial and AR/AP of these two facilities.
This role is responsible for ensuring accurate financial reporting, maintaining internal systems, and supporting budgeting, vendor management, and operational reporting.
This position works closely with internal leadership, clinical operators, and third-party vendors to ensure timely and accurate financial information, while supporting the unique needs of a healthcare operating business.
Key Responsibilities:
· Manage accounts payable and accounts receivable processes for the clinic and surgery center
· Prepare and support recurring financial reporting, including performance tracking for healthcare operations
· Maintain and monitor outstanding accounts receivable, including reporting on aging balances and allocating collections across entities Assist with internal time tracking and coordination across administrative and clinical support functions
· Review payroll for accuracy, including coordination with third-party providers and internal staff
· Respond to ad hoc financial reporting and analysis requests from leadership
· Process and manage vendor applications, including coordination with medical and facility vendors
· Generate recurring and custom financial, operational, and KPI reports
· Assist with budget updates and modifications based on operational needs and performance trends
· Support Monthly Operating Report (MOR) preparation and review
· Participate in annual and periodic budget preparation processes, including coordination with clinical leadership
